Chapter 515 Life in prison isn't so bad?

Ugh—

Lying in bed, Loira began to wonder what day it was.

It seems they've been detained for two days already, right?

Nothing much has happened in the last two days. Mr. Parkinson, Mr. Shackle, and Miss Tonks have all come by. Unlike Mr. Parkinson, Mr. Shackle and Miss Tonks, who know Dumbledore's thoughts, came more to check on the situation.

However, Loila felt that she was more there to reassure herself—after all, being suddenly and inexplicably grabbed like that was quite strange.

No matter how you look at it, it doesn't make you feel at ease.

Of course, this glass jar was much more comfortable than Loila had expected. The bed was large, and the lunch and dinner were quite good. For one thing, the food at the Ministry of Magic was pretty tasty.

More importantly, Loila isn't bored here.

Because Miss Nagini is here too.

This morning, Miss Nagini transformed into a snake and followed Mr. Shackleton into the room. Of course, Miss Nagini seemed to know about Dumbledore's arrangements, and although she was very unhappy, she seemed to have been persuaded.

Feeling the coldness curled up inside her sleeve, Loila felt much more at ease.

And along with Miss Nagini came her wand—well, if it weren't for Dumbledore's arrangement, Royla would have liked to just flick her wand and escape from here.

However, after hearing Miss Tonks say, "Headmaster Dumbledore will count these days as overtime," Royla's desire to escape was no longer so strong.

Anyway, I've been caught before—and I was locked up for several months that time—it's much better here than in Germany.

This is something the Germans should learn from the British.

"Pat-pat-pat"

Just as Loila was lying in bed lost in thought, she suddenly heard footsteps. This made her instinctively tighten her grip on the wand in her sleeve and look outside warily.

She recognized the footsteps. They weren't those of Jack, the guard, nor those of Mr. Parkinson and Mr. Shackles; they were Fudge's footsteps.

"Good morning, Miss Hamilton." Fudge stood in front of the glass with a complicated expression, looking quite tired.

"Good morning—good morning." Loila pursed her lips and carefully sat up.

Why did he suddenly come? Is he here to release me? Or to pronounce my sentence? If he's going to carry out the death penalty immediately, I'll have to fight back.

Not only the wand, but Miss Nagini, huddled in her sleeve, also seemed ready. Loila could faintly hear her hissing, which carried an aggressive undertone.

"I have some questions for you." As he spoke again, Loila noticed that he seemed to be all alone—he hadn't brought any other Aurors with him.

That's... a bit strange...

Won't they tell me they want to make some kind of secret deal with me?

This furtive manner—

"Do you know what's been happening outside these past few days?" he asked slowly, his tone hardly friendly.

Hey! How dare you speak to a criminal like that? Don't you know you can't contact the outside world from here?

Loila shook her head and said, "I don't know."

"Isn't this...this isn't a prison?"

"This is not a prison, Miss Hamilton," Fudge corrected. "This is a temporary prison."

Are you sick?

Loila felt that Fudge might be a little... a little mentally unstable... Weren't you here to ask about something? How come you have time to correct this?

"So—so what's going on outside?" Loila asked curiously, since neither Mr. Shakel nor Miss Tonks had told her about what was happening outside.

Fudge looked at Loila in silence for a few seconds, then finally took a deep breath and said, "Nothing."

Loila was speechless—she looked at Fudge, unsure how to respond. The only thing she could think of saying was, "Avada Kedavra," or "Crucible."

"Miss Hamilton—I don't think you'd want to be locked up here forever, would you?" Fudge coughed lightly, changing the subject.

Hmm—thinking about it carefully—this place isn't that different from Hogwarts—Miss Nagini is here to keep me company, and I even get extra pay—and people come to chat with me every now and then.

I don't even have to work — I don't even have to deal with students — the more I talk about it, the more I feel like this place is pretty good!

The only downside is that the space is a bit small—and there's not much of a view. It would be great if your prison could be renovated.

Oh, it's a temporary prison.

But all in all, Loila wasn't really keen on going out—she might have been a little scared at first, but now she was just at ease.

He readily accepted Dumbledore's money for nothing.

Seeing Roy remain silent, Fudge continued, "Miss Hamilton—I know you definitely want to leave."

I don't want to————

"That's why I'm here to talk to you," Fudge said, bending down. "If you want—you can do more than just go out."

"And he can become the director again."

Hmm—is it really appropriate to appoint someone who's just been released from prison as a director or something? I thought Dumbledore was already incredibly bold to let me be a professor—

Are you lying to me again?

After thinking for a moment, Loila bit her lip and said, "What is it?"

What are the things you mean by "I'm willing"?

Wait a minute—you didn't come here alone for *that* kind of thing, did you?!

Loila seemed to realize something and immediately took a few steps back. "I—I'm warning you—Veera isn't—isn't that kind of person—if you try anything, I have a wand—"

And poisonous snakes—yes, I'll release snakes to bite you!

Loila's actions seemed to make Fudge realize something. He stared at Loila with wide eyes, then took a deep breath and said, "Miss Hamilton—I'm here to negotiate, not to talk about love."

Hmm—he seems angry—

Seeing Fudge's dark expression, Loila twitched her ears awkwardly.

He doesn't seem to have that kind of thought at all—what is it then?

"Miss Hamilton, you are an excellent wizard, and a person of great talent—I believe you also know—Dumbledore's lies won't last long." Fudge paused for a few seconds before slowly saying, "His lies about the Man of Void will soon be exposed, and his desire to seize the Ministry of Magic will also be revealed—"

Why are you still dwelling on this? — Sometimes Loila didn't know what to say. She felt the same despair as discovering after class that the student who walked in was a troll.

Okay, that seems a bit disrespectful to others.

“But Miss Hamilton, you can speed things up,” Fudge said softly. “If you’re willing—you can expose Dumbledore’s plot.”

"Then you will get what you want."

Is all I want to do to leave here and become a director?

I feel like your conditions are really insincere—look at Voldemort, he just opened his mouth and said he'd rule the wizarding world—no wonder you can't beat him—

"Then—what if I refuse?" Loila thought for a moment and asked softly.

"Refuse?" Fudge shook his head slightly upon hearing this. "Then all that awaits you is judgment."

"Miss Hamilton—in the courtroom—you will be all alone."
